Hi Mike,=20

Alexandr is right, what I described should work for binary kernels and not f=
or ELF ones. I somehow was of the impression that you were using binary. Ple=
ase try the same with binary kernel per Alexandr's suggestion in an earlier p=
ost...

>> On 10/05/2017 08:16, Stanislav Galabov wrote:
>> Hi Mike,
>>=20
>> Please try setting both the Load Address and the Entry Point to the same v=
alue as you see as Entry point address by using 'readelf -h=E2=80=99 and try=
 booting again.
>> In your case this would seem to be 0x80001100.
>>=20
>> Please leave all dts/dtsi files unchanged (as they originally were) for n=
ow.
